- /****************************************************************************
- * Included Files
- ****************************************************************************/
- #include <nuttx/config.h>
- #if defined(CONFIG_NET) && defined(CONFIG_NET_LOCAL)
- #include <sys/stat.h>
- #include <sys/ioctl.h>
- #include <stdbool.h>
- #include <stdio.h>
- #include <unistd.h>
- #include <fcntl.h>
- #include <string.h>
- #include <errno.h>
- #include <assert.h>
- #include "local/local.h"
- /****************************************************************************
- * Private Functions
- ****************************************************************************/
- #define LOCAL_CS_SUFFIX "CS" /* Name of the client-to-server FIFO */
- #define LOCAL_SC_SUFFIX "SC" /* Name of the server-to-client FIFO */
- #define LOCAL_HD_SUFFIX "HD" /* Name of the half duplex datagram FIFO */
- #define LOCAL_SUFFIX_LEN 2
- #define LOCAL_FULLPATH_LEN (UNIX_PATH_MAX + LOCAL_SUFFIX_LEN)
- /****************************************************************************
- * Private Functions
- ****************************************************************************/
- /****************************************************************************
- * Name: local_cs_name
- *
- * Description:
- * Create the name of the client-to-server FIFO.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_STREAM
- static inline void local_cs_name(FAR struct local_conn_s *conn,
- FAR char *path)
- {
- if (conn->lc_instance_id < 0)
- {
- (void)snprintf(path, LOCAL_FULLPATH_LEN - 1, "%s" LOCAL_CS_SUFFIX,
- conn->lc_path);
- }
- else
- {
- (void)snprintf(path, LOCAL_FULLPATH_LEN - 1, "%s" LOCAL_CS_SUFFIX "%x",
- conn->lc_path, conn->lc_instance_id);
- }
- path[LOCAL_FULLPATH_LEN - 1] = '\0';
- }
- #endif /* CONFIG_NET_LOCAL_STREAM */
- /****************************************************************************
- * Name: local_sc_name
- *
- * Description:
- * Create the name of the server-to-client FIFO.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_STREAM
- static inline void local_sc_name(FAR struct local_conn_s *conn,
- FAR char *path)
- {
- if (conn->lc_instance_id < 0)
- {
- (void)snprintf(path, LOCAL_FULLPATH_LEN - 1, "%s" LOCAL_SC_SUFFIX,
- conn->lc_path);
- }
- else
- {
- (void)snprintf(path, LOCAL_FULLPATH_LEN - 1, "%s" LOCAL_SC_SUFFIX "%x",
- conn->lc_path, conn->lc_instance_id);
- }
- path[LOCAL_FULLPATH_LEN - 1] = '\0';
- }
- #endif /* CONFIG_NET_LOCAL_STREAM */
- /****************************************************************************
- * Name: local_hd_name
- *
- * Description:
- * Create the name of the half duplex, datagram FIFO.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_DGRAM
- static inline void local_hd_name(FAR const char *inpath, FAR char *outpath)
- {
- (void)snprintf(outpath, LOCAL_FULLPATH_LEN - 1, "%s" LOCAL_HD_SUFFIX,
- inpath);
- outpath[LOCAL_FULLPATH_LEN - 1] = '\0';
- }
- #endif /* CONFIG_NET_LOCAL_DGRAM */
- /****************************************************************************
- * Name: local_fifo_exists
- *
- * Description:
- * Check if a FIFO exists.
- *
- ****************************************************************************/
- static bool local_fifo_exists(FAR const char *path)
- {
- struct stat buf;
- int ret;
- /* Create the client-to-server FIFO */
- ret = stat(path, &buf);
- if (ret < 0)
- {
- return false;
- }
- /* FIFOs are character devices in NuttX. Return true if what we found
- * is a FIFO. What if it is something else? In that case, we will
- * return false and mkfifo() will fail.
- */
- return (bool)S_ISCHR(buf.st_mode);
- }
- /****************************************************************************
- * Name: local_create_fifo
- *
- * Description:
- * Create the one FIFO.
- *
- ****************************************************************************/
- static int local_create_fifo(FAR const char *path)
- {
- int ret;
- /* Create the client-to-server FIFO if it does not already exist. */
- if (!local_fifo_exists(path))
- {
- ret = mkfifo(path, 0644);
- if (ret < 0)
- {
- int errcode = get_errno();
- DEBUGASSERT(errcode > 0);
- nerr("ERROR: Failed to create FIFO %s: %d\n", path, errcode);
- return -errcode;
- }
- }
- /* The FIFO (or some character driver) exists at PATH or we successfully
- * created the FIFO at that location.
- */
- return OK;
- }
- /****************************************************************************
- * Name: local_release_fifo
- *
- * Description:
- * Release a reference from one of the FIFOs used in a connection.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_STREAM /* Currently not used by datagram code */
- static int local_release_fifo(FAR const char *path)
- {
- int ret;
- /* Unlink the client-to-server FIFO if it exists. */
- if (local_fifo_exists(path))
- {
- /* Un-linking the FIFO removes the FIFO from the namespace. It will
- * also mark the FIFO device "unlinked". When all of the open
- * references to the FIFO device are closed, the resources consumed
- * by the device instance will also be freed.
- */
- ret = unlink(path);
- if (ret < 0)
- {
- int errcode = get_errno();
- DEBUGASSERT(errcode > 0);
- nerr("ERROR: Failed to unlink FIFO %s: %d\n", path, errcode);
- return -errcode;
- }
- }
- /* The FIFO does not exist or we successfully unlinked it. */
- return OK;
- }
- #endif
- /****************************************************************************
- * Name: local_rx_open
- *
- * Description:
- * Open a FIFO for read-only access.
- *
- ****************************************************************************/
- static int local_rx_open(FAR struct local_conn_s *conn, FAR const char *path,
- bool nonblock)
- {
- int oflags = nonblock ? O_RDONLY | O_NONBLOCK : O_RDONLY;
- int ret;
- ret = file_open(&conn->lc_infile, path, oflags);
- if (ret < 0)
- {
- nerr("ERROR: Failed on open %s for reading: %d\n",
- path, ret);
- /* Map the error code to something consistent with the return
- * error codes from connect():
- *
- * If error is ENOENT, meaning that the FIFO does exist,
- * return EFAULT meaning that the socket structure address is
- * outside the user's address space.
- */
- return ret == -ENOENT ? -EFAULT : ret;
- }
- return OK;
- }
- /****************************************************************************
- * Name: local_tx_open
- *
- * Description:
- * Open a FIFO for write-only access.
- *
- ****************************************************************************/
- static int local_tx_open(FAR struct local_conn_s *conn, FAR const char *path,
- bool nonblock)
- {
- int oflags = nonblock ? O_WRONLY | O_NONBLOCK : O_WRONLY;
- int ret;
- ret = file_open(&conn->lc_outfile, path, oflags);
- if (ret < 0)
- {
- nerr("ERROR: Failed on open %s for writing: %d\n",
- path, ret);
- /* Map the error code to something consistent with the return
- * error codes from connect():
- *
- * If error is ENOENT, meaning that the FIFO does exist,
- * return EFAULT meaning that the socket structure address is
- * outside the user's address space.
- */
- return ret == -ENOENT ? -EFAULT : ret;
- }
- return OK;
- }
- /****************************************************************************
- * Name: local_set_policy
- *
- * Description:
- * Set the FIFO buffer policy:
- *
- * 0=Free FIFO resources when the last reference is closed
- * 1=Free FIFO resources when the buffer is empty.
- *
- ****************************************************************************/
- static int local_set_policy(FAR struct file *filep, unsigned long policy)
- {
- int ret;
- /* Set the buffer policy */
- ret = file_ioctl(filep, PIPEIOC_POLICY, policy);
- if (ret < 0)
- {
- nerr("ERROR: Failed to set FIFO buffer policty: %d\n", ret);
- }
- return ret;
- }
- /****************************************************************************
- * Public Functions
- ****************************************************************************/
- /****************************************************************************
- * Name: local_create_fifos
- *
- * Description:
- * Create the FIFO pair needed for a SOCK_STREAM connection.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_STREAM
- int local_create_fifos(FAR struct local_conn_s *conn)
- {
- char path[LOCAL_FULLPATH_LEN];
- int ret;
- /* Create the client-to-server FIFO if it does not already exist. */
- local_cs_name(conn, path);
- ret = local_create_fifo(path);
- if (ret >= 0)
- {
- /* Create the server-to-client FIFO if it does not already exist. */
- local_sc_name(conn, path);
- ret = local_create_fifo(path);
- }
- return ret;
- }
- #endif /* CONFIG_NET_LOCAL_STREAM */
- /****************************************************************************
- * Name: local_create_halfduplex
- *
- * Description:
- * Create the half-duplex FIFO needed for SOCK_DGRAM communication.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_DGRAM
- int local_create_halfduplex(FAR struct local_conn_s *conn, FAR const char *path)
- {
- char fullpath[LOCAL_FULLPATH_LEN];
- /* Create the half duplex FIFO if it does not already exist. */
- local_hd_name(path, fullpath);
- return local_create_fifo(fullpath);
- }
- #endif /* CONFIG_NET_LOCAL_DGRAM */
- /****************************************************************************
- * Name: local_release_fifos
- *
- * Description:
- * Release references to the FIFO pair used for a SOCK_STREAM connection.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_STREAM
- int local_release_fifos(FAR struct local_conn_s *conn)
- {
- char path[LOCAL_FULLPATH_LEN];
- int ret1;
- int ret2;
- /* Destroy the client-to-server FIFO if it exists. */
- local_sc_name(conn, path);
- ret1 = local_release_fifo(path);
- /* Destroy the server-to-client FIFO if it exists. */
- local_cs_name(conn, path);
- ret2 = local_release_fifo(path);
- /* Return a failure if one occurred. */
- return ret1 < 0 ? ret1 : ret2;
- }
- #endif /* CONFIG_NET_LOCAL_STREAM */
- /****************************************************************************
- * Name: local_release_halfduplex
- *
- * Description:
- * Release a reference to the FIFO used for SOCK_DGRAM communication
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_DGRAM
- int local_release_halfduplex(FAR struct local_conn_s *conn)
- {
- #if 1
- /* REVIST: We need to think about this carefully. Unlike the connection-
- * oriented Unix domain socket, we don't really know the best time to
- * release the FIFO resource. It would be extremely inefficient to create
- * and destroy the FIFO on each packet. But, on the other hand, failing
- * to destory the FIFO will leave the FIFO resources in place after the
- * communications have completed.
- *
- * I am thinking that there should be something like a timer. The timer
- * would be started at the completion of each transfer and cancelled at
- * the beginning of each transfer. If the timer expires, then the FIFO
- * would be destroyed.
- */
- # warning Missing logic
- return OK;
- #else
- char path[LOCAL_FULLPATH_LEN];
- /* Destroy the half duplex FIFO if it exists. */
- local_hd_name(conn->lc_path, path);
- return local_release_fifo(path);
- #endif
- }
- #endif /* CONFIG_NET_LOCAL_DGRAM */
- /****************************************************************************
- * Name: local_open_client_rx
- *
- * Description:
- * Open the client-side of the server-to-client FIFO.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_STREAM
- int local_open_client_rx(FAR struct local_conn_s *client, bool nonblock)
- {
- char path[LOCAL_FULLPATH_LEN];
- int ret;
- /* Get the server-to-client path name */
- local_sc_name(client, path);
- /* Then open the file for read-only access */
- ret = local_rx_open(client, path, nonblock);
- if (ret == OK)
- {
- /* Policy: Free FIFO resources when the last reference is closed */
- ret = local_set_policy(&client->lc_infile, 0);
- }
- return ret;
- }
- #endif /* CONFIG_NET_LOCAL_STREAM */
- /****************************************************************************
- * Name: local_open_client_tx
- *
- * Description:
- * Open the client-side of the client-to-server FIFO.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_STREAM
- int local_open_client_tx(FAR struct local_conn_s *client, bool nonblock)
- {
- char path[LOCAL_FULLPATH_LEN];
- int ret;
- /* Get the client-to-server path name */
- local_cs_name(client, path);
- /* Then open the file for write-only access */
- ret = local_tx_open(client, path, nonblock);
- if (ret == OK)
- {
- /* Policy: Free FIFO resources when the last reference is closed */
- ret = local_set_policy(&client->lc_outfile, 0);
- }
- return ret;
- }
- #endif /* CONFIG_NET_LOCAL_STREAM */
- /****************************************************************************
- * Name: local_open_server_rx
- *
- * Description:
- * Open the server-side of the client-to-server FIFO.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_STREAM
- int local_open_server_rx(FAR struct local_conn_s *server, bool nonblock)
- {
- char path[LOCAL_FULLPATH_LEN];
- int ret;
- /* Get the client-to-server path name */
- local_cs_name(server, path);
- /* Then open the file for write-only access */
- ret = local_rx_open(server, path, nonblock);
- if (ret == OK)
- {
- /* Policy: Free FIFO resources when the last reference is closed */
- ret = local_set_policy(&server->lc_infile, 0);
- }
- return ret;
- }
- #endif /* CONFIG_NET_LOCAL_STREAM */
- /****************************************************************************
- * Name: local_open_server_tx
- *
- * Description:
- * Only the server-side of the server-to-client FIFO.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_STREAM
- int local_open_server_tx(FAR struct local_conn_s *server, bool nonblock)
- {
- char path[LOCAL_FULLPATH_LEN];
- int ret;
- /* Get the server-to-client path name */
- local_sc_name(server, path);
- /* Then open the file for read-only access */
- ret = local_tx_open(server, path, nonblock);
- if (ret == OK)
- {
- /* Policy: Free FIFO resources when the last reference is closed */
- ret = local_set_policy(&server->lc_outfile, 0);
- }
- return ret;
- }
- #endif /* CONFIG_NET_LOCAL_STREAM */
- /****************************************************************************
- * Name: local_open_receiver
- *
- * Description:
- * Only the receiving side of the half duplex FIFO.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_DGRAM
- int local_open_receiver(FAR struct local_conn_s *conn, bool nonblock)
- {
- char path[LOCAL_FULLPATH_LEN];
- int ret;
- /* Get the server-to-client path name */
- local_hd_name(conn->lc_path, path);
- /* Then open the file for read-only access */
- ret = local_rx_open(conn, path, nonblock);
- if (ret == OK)
- {
- /* Policy: Free FIFO resources when the buffer is empty. */
- ret = local_set_policy(&conn->lc_infile, 1);
- }
- return ret;
- }
- #endif /* CONFIG_NET_LOCAL_DGRAM */
- /****************************************************************************
- * Name: local_open_sender
- *
- * Description:
- * Only the sending side of the half duplex FIFO.
- *
- ****************************************************************************/
- #ifdef CONFIG_NET_LOCAL_DGRAM
- int local_open_sender(FAR struct local_conn_s *conn, FAR const char *path,
- bool nonblock)
- {
- char fullpath[LOCAL_FULLPATH_LEN];
- int ret;
- /* Get the server-to-client path name */
- local_hd_name(path, fullpath);
- /* Then open the file for read-only access */
- ret = local_tx_open(conn, fullpath, nonblock);
- if (ret == OK)
- {
- /* Policy: Free FIFO resources when the buffer is empty. */
- ret = local_set_policy(&conn->lc_outfile, 1);
- }
- return ret;
- }
- #endif /* CONFIG_NET_LOCAL_DGRAM */
- #endif /* CONFIG_NET && CONFIG_NET_LOCAL */
